[Intraoperative sonography to exclude thoracic injury].
Zsolt Baranyai1, Valéria Jósa, Ferenc Jakab
1Fovárosi Onkormányzat Uzsoki utcai Kórház Sebészeti, Ersebészeti Osztály. barazso@uzoki.hu
Orvosi Hetilap
|August 7, 2007
Summary
Intraoperative ultrasonography aided in diagnosing diaphragmatic injuries after abdominal stab wounds. This technique successfully excluded intrathoracic injury, avoiding exploratory thoracotomy in a trauma case.

Background:
- Abdominal stab wounds can lead to severe complications, including diaphragmatic injuries.
- Hypovolemic shock necessitates rapid surgical intervention (laparotomy).
- Assessing diaphragmatic integrity post-trauma can be challenging.
Observation:
- A 29-year-old female presented with an abdominal stab wound and hypovolemic shock.
- Laparotomy revealed splenectomy and gastric suture were required.
- A left diaphragmatic wound was noted, with unclear penetrating status.
Findings:
- Intraoperative ultrasonography was utilized to assess the diaphragmatic wound from the abdominal cavity.
- The ultrasonography was performed using a sterile-covered transducer and acoustic gel.
- This imaging modality effectively excluded any intrathoracic injury adjacent to the diaphragm.
Implications:
- Intraoperative ultrasonography offers a non-invasive method to evaluate diaphragmatic injuries during laparotomy.
- It can help avoid unnecessary exploratory thoracotomy, reducing patient morbidity.
- This technique enhances diagnostic accuracy in complex trauma cases involving the diaphragm.

Ultrasonography
Ultrasonography is an imaging technique that uses high-frequency sound waves to visualize the body's internal structures. It is a non-invasive and safe procedure that does not involve the use of ionizing radiation, making it widely used in various medical fields. Ultrasonography is used to study heart function, blood flow in the neck or extremities, certain conditions such as gallbladder disease, and fetal growth and development.

Endoscopic Studies II: Thoracocentesis
Thoracentesis(Thoracocentesis), commonly known as pleural tap, is a medical procedure where a 22 gauge needle is inserted into the pleural space, the area between the lung and chest wall. This procedure is commonly performed to diagnose or treat various respiratory disorders.

Imaging Studies for Cardiovascular System I:Echocardiography
Cardiac imaging studies encompass a wide range of noninvasive and minimally invasive techniques designed to visualize the heart's structure and function in detail. One such technique is echocardiography, which uses high-frequency ultrasound waves to produce detailed images of the heart, known as echocardiograms.
